Most workshop design optimizes for a single outcome: successful completion of the session itself. Participants stay engaged, the content lands well in the room, satisfaction scores come back strong. And then, within a matter of weeks, much of what was covered fails to show up as changed behavior back on the job. This is not typically a failure of facilitation skill. It reflects a structural mismatch between what workshops are usually designed to achieve and what the available research suggests actually predicts durable behavior change afterward.
The training transfer literature draws a fairly consistent distinction between learning and transfer as two separate, measurable outcomes. Learning is assessable at the end of a session — participants can recall the framework presented, demonstrate the skill in a low-stakes practice exercise, articulate clearly why the concept matters. Transfer is a separate, later measurement: whether that skill actually shows up, without prompting, in real working conditions weeks or months afterward. The gap between these two outcomes is often substantial in the research literature, and workshop designs optimized primarily for the first outcome tend to do comparatively little to close the second.

Several specific design elements have shown associations with stronger transfer outcomes across multiple studies. One is the inclusion of implementation intentions — concrete, specific "if this situation happens, I will do that particular thing" plans built and written down during the session itself, rather than left as a vague general takeaway for participants to work out later on their own. Participants who leave a session with a specific, pre-committed plan for when and how they will apply a new skill tend to show meaningfully higher application rates afterward compared to participants who leave with general understanding of the concept alone.
A second element is spaced reinforcement. Single-session workshops, however well designed and well delivered, compete against the ordinary tendency of unreinforced information to fade substantially within weeks of initial exposure. Programs that build in even brief follow-up touchpoints after the main session — a short check-in conversation, a prompted written reflection, a peer accountability structure — tend to show meaningfully better transfer outcomes in comparative studies than single-exposure formats, even when the total amount of instructional content delivered is roughly similar between the two approaches.
A third factor involves deliberately designing for the participant's actual working environment rather than an idealized version of it. Workshops that include explicit planning around likely real-world obstacles — naming specifically what will make the new skill hard to apply in practice, and what the participant intends to do when that obstacle shows up — tend to produce more durable transfer than workshops that present the skill only under favorable, uncomplicated conditions and leave obstacle navigation entirely to chance once the participant is back at work.
It is worth being careful not to overstate how mechanical or guaranteed this process is. These design elements are associated with improved transfer outcomes across a body of research, but none of them functions as a guarantee, and the actual size of the effect varies meaningfully depending on the specific skill being trained, the organizational context, and individual differences among learners. Implementation intentions, for example, appear to help most reliably with well-defined, specific behaviors, and less reliably with more diffuse or complex changes that resist being reduced to a single clear if-then plan.
There is also a design tension worth naming honestly: adding spacing, obstacle-planning, and implementation-intention exercises genuinely takes time away from core content delivery within a fixed session length. This is a real tradeoff, not a free improvement, and it means workshop designers are often choosing to cover somewhat less material in exchange for a higher likelihood that whatever is covered actually transfers. The research generally suggests this tradeoff favors transfer-focused design when the explicit goal is behavior change rather than pure content coverage, but that is a judgment call specific to the actual objective of a given program, not a universal rule that applies identically to every training context.

For workshop designers and L&D professionals, the practical shift this suggests is moving the primary evaluation criterion further upstream: designing not simply for "did this land well in the room," but for "what specific mechanism built into this design is actually responsible for behavior still being measurably different ninety days later." That reframing tends to change what gets built into a session — somewhat less raw content volume, considerably more built-in implementation planning, deliberate spacing, and honest, specific obstacle-mapping done collaboratively with participants rather than left implicit.
There is a further consideration worth naming for designers weighing these tradeoffs: the value of transfer-focused design tends to scale with how much the organization actually intends to change behavior versus simply raise awareness. A session meant primarily to introduce a concept for later reference has less need for heavy implementation-intention scaffolding than a session meant to produce an immediate, measurable shift in how people handle a specific recurring situation. Treating every workshop as equally in need of the full transfer-optimized design can waste effort on sessions where awareness alone was actually the legitimate goal, while under-investing in the smaller number of sessions where durable behavior change was the real point all along. Being explicit about which goal a given session is actually serving, before designing it, helps avoid applying a heavy transfer framework where it isn't warranted, and helps ensure it gets applied consistently where it is.
There is also a timing consideration independent of format: the closer the follow-up touchpoint sits to the original session, the higher its completion rate tends to be, with effectiveness dropping off noticeably once the gap stretches past a few weeks. This suggests spacing needs to be deliberate and reasonably prompt rather than simply "sometime later" — a vaguely scheduled follow-up carries much less of the intended benefit than one anchored to a specific, near-term date set during the original session itself.

It's also worth acknowledging that much of this evidence comes from studies with real methodological limitations — modest sample sizes, reliance on self-report, and settings that don't always generalize cleanly across industries or cultures. The overall direction of the findings, favoring transfer-conscious design over content-volume-focused design, appears fairly consistent across the available research. The precise magnitude of any individual technique's effect should be treated as directional rather than as a fixed, universally applicable number.
A further practical question designers face is how much of this transfer-supporting work belongs inside the workshop itself versus outside it, closer to the participant's actual job. Building implementation-intention exercises into the session guarantees they happen but competes directly for limited session time. Pushing that work to a post-session assignment preserves session time but relies on participants actually completing something unsupervised, which tends to see substantially lower completion rates than in-session work. Programs that split the difference — a brief in-session start to the implementation plan, completed in more detail afterward with light structured prompting rather than left fully open-ended — appear to capture some of the benefit of both approaches without the full time cost or the full completion risk of either extreme.
